Hi Forum,

Every year i seem to burn out one or two of these ..... are their drop in replacement LED bulbs for these very common, Halogen 12V, two screw lamps. I think my pool store charges ~$30 for one standard halogen PAR56????

I see a lot of those electronic multi-color LED PAR56 bulbs but what about just white light and cheap.

actually, there are many PAR56 Pool Light in the market, which can be instead of tranditional(halogen kind), and they can be multi-color, or single color(red, blue, green, white.ect).

about the price, it depends what watt, and what color do you need, there are 18W(252 pcs LED),22W(315 LED),24W(351LED),36W(510LED),39W(546LED), and there are some with high power led, 12 pcs 1W LED(12x1W=36W), and 18x3W,ect.

and here is the calculation, 1W LED=3W CFL=15W halogen, so you know what watt you need to buy to replace your halogen 300W PAR56.
 
I am not an LeD expert but in my readings CREE is a company that makes the LEDs for lamps like these. Manufacturers make the bulb forms and use the CREE elements. I have read several times that CREE elements are worth paying extra for, regardless of the name on the bulb. I assume the companies that use these elements advertise they are using CREE
